Output 26407ab1da5782d228b665365b0ada13df601ac94711f65eb875b496aa97c8f9:36

value
54000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37491caffa57879ddd5466262617beec0f12e35b OP_EQUAL
address
36jLg1Vy1MnaWLri6BqGanoH5NENni7K1D
transaction
26407ab1da5782d228b665365b0ada13df601ac94711f65eb875b496aa97c8f9
confirmations
242823
spent
true